When deciding how many fish to add in your aquarium the basic rule of thumb with most aquariums is one half inch of fish per gallon, keeping in mind the size they will grow to. We typically recommend between 5-7 although this will depend on the other tank mates you have. They can grow up to 3”. They are a great addition as they have a lot of personality.

I think its good to add atleast ten. Chromis have a bad track record in small groups in the aquarium. They will usually pick each other off one-by-one if the agression is not widely dispersed.
